THE BARN @ THE ELMS, family friendly, with a garden in Admaston
The Barn @ The Elms, near Admaston, Shropshire sleeps five guests in three rooms
The Barn @ The Elms, a house consists of a kitchen/diner with electric oven and hob, microwave, washing machine, kettle, and toaster, and a living/dining room with TV, WiFi, and a selection of books and games. The bedrooms consist of two doubles and a twin. Outside, there is a rear enclosed garden with astroturf area and furniture and off-road parking for three cars. Highchair and travel cot available. Sorry, no smoking. Shop 2.8 miles, pub 2.3 miles, river 0.3 miles. Visit The Barn @ The Elms for your next adventure. Note: Property located beside owner's property. Note: Check-in 3pm, check-out 10am. Note: worker/contractor bookings are welcome, but they are subject to an inspection during their stay.
Amenities: Ground source heating. Electric oven and induction hob, microwave, fridge/freezer, dishwasher, kettle, toaster. TV, WiFi, selection of books and games. Fuel and power inc. in rent. Bed linen and towels inc. in rent. Travel cot and highchair available. Off-road parking for 3 cars. Rear enclosed garden with astroturf area and furniture. Sorry, no pets and no smoking. Shop 2.8 miles, pub 2.3 miles, river 0.3 miles. Note: Property located beside owner's property. Note: Check-in 3pm, check-out 10am. Note: worker/contractor bookings are welcome, but they are subject to an inspection during their stay.
Region: A E Housman once wrote that Shropshire was âthe quietest place under the sunâ and today the county remains something of a rural idyll, recognised as one of the least crowded and most peaceful regions in England.
Town: Admaston is a village resting on the outskirts of Telford, Shropshire. The town offers a good selection of cafes, pubs, and eateries, as well as convenience stores where you can pick up all of your holiday essentials. Dining options include The Pheasant Inn, and more amenities can be found in Telford, as well as a selection of independent shops, retail stores, and the Exotic Zoo Wildlife Park. Nature lovers can explore local wildlife at the National Trust's Attingham Park, Bowring District Park, Dothill Local Nature Reserve and Ercall Nature Reserve. If you love to discover local history, head over to Wroxeter Roman Village and Wroxeter Roman Vineyard, sampling the delights on offer. Other places to visit include the remarkable National Trust-owned Sunnycroft, where you can learn about familial and servant life during the Victorian era. Guests can spend a day shopping in Shrewsbury, or viisting Shrewsbury Abbey, or for a walk amongst the scenery, head out to the Shropshire Hills National Landscape, ideal for birdwatching.
